What's The Definition Of Opinicus?Synonyms | Synonyms for Opinicus: Related Terms | Find terms related to Opinicus: See Also | Opinicus In Webster's Dictionary \O*pin"i*cus\, n. (Her.)
An imaginary animal borne as a charge, having wings, an
eagle's head, and a short tail; -- sometimes represented
without wings.
